Samsung Galaxy S10 Plus Model Number SM-G975* Differences

By Tuan Do

The Samsung Galaxy S10 Plus is a high-end smartphone in the Galaxy S lineup released in its 10th anniversary. It has the price tag of $999 and comes with many changes from the hardware inside to the redesigned exterior.

The most impressive feature of the Galaxy S10 Plus is its mesmerizing Infinity-O display; That is a massive 6.4-inch Dynamic AMOLED display with a precise cutout on the front for cameras, in-display Ultrasonic Fingerprint Scanner, HDR10+ certification, lower blue light emission, and accurate colors in any lighting condition.

Besides, it is equipped with a bigger 4,100mAh battery, a triple camera setup (telephoto, wide-angle, and ultra-wide lenses) on the back, and dual front cameras. The phone is also more powerful with the Qualcomm Snapdragon 855 or Samsung Exynos 9820 processor which can deliver 29% and 37% faster CPU and GPU performance respectively. Notably, the maxed-out S10 Plus has 12GB RAM and 1TB of internal storage which is expandable to 1.5TB with a microSD card.

The Samsung Galaxy S10 Plus comes in many model numbers for different markets and carriers. You should check the model number carefully before ordering the phone because the models have different processors, built-in storage, RAM, and supported cellular bands. All the model numbers start with SM-G975 but the latter characters are different. Let’s check out the differences between those models.
